The present paper deals with the development and implementation of numerical methods for investigating the stress-strain state of elastic-plastic solids with large deformations. An incremental loading technique is used. Spatial discretization is based on the finite element method. Using the proposed procedure, the problem of elastic-plastic deformations of a pipe and the problem of tension of a round bar are solved.
Keywords: finite elastic-plastic deformations, additive decomposition of total strains, linearized physical relations.
